The rod on the right The Browning IM6 is a superb rod all the Fuji gear on it , full cork etc & over here it's sold with a hard canvass carry bag.

Retails Aus $250

Be alot cheaper over where you are bigger market means cheaper prices & yes it is available in the States

Rod itself is a joy to spin with , very good for tossing those very light SP's it's action allows you to really whip out the hard body lures as well I was really surprised how far I could whip them out

Aftco is good gear & I use it on my game rods

Just started using the Aftco resin & not bad stuff either a bit slower curing time than the previous resin I was using but the aftco seems to be alot clearer

Jumpy. Was thinking of a 15kg 6' 6" med/heavy fast taper blank that I could build myself.
As for pre built rod, it would have to be similar function as the above, overhead of coarse.
I am going to use it for bottom bashing with tld15 and 30 lb braid, in bepths between 80-160 metres.
Any shallower then 80 metres and I use my spinfishers, any deeper then 160m and the deck winch will come into play. Or my crab pot recovery system that I am going to make.
